Teeth Whitening Pricing in Texas

In Texas, the average cost for teeth whitening is $372 per treatment, which is 7% lower than the national average of $400. Most Texas residents pay between $93 and $744.

Texas has costs that track closely with the national average, though prices can still vary between urban and rural areas within the state.

Professional teeth whitening uses stronger bleaching agents than over-the-counter products, delivering faster and more dramatic results in a dental office setting.

What Affects Teeth Whitening Cost in Texas?

Type

In-office (Zoom, BriteSmile): $400-$800. Custom take-home trays: $200-$500. Over-the-counter: $20-$100

Sessions

Some patients need 2-3 in-office sessions for best results

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does professional whitening last?

Results typically last 6 months to 2 years depending on diet and habits.

Is teeth whitening safe?

Yes. Professional whitening is safe when performed correctly. Temporary sensitivity is the most common side effect.
